Glacier National Park, situated in West Glacier, MT, is a stunning natural haven encompassing over a million acres of wilderness. Established in 1910, this park is a testament to the NPS's dedication to conserving our nation's most precious landscapes. Visitors can revel in the park's diverse ecosystems, from rugged mountains to pristine lakes, making it a must-visit for nature enthusiasts.
With over 700 miles of hiking trails and a plethora of wildlife, Glacier National Park offers a truly immersive outdoor experience. The park's rich history and cultural significance add depth to its beauty, providing a unique blend of adventure and education for all who explore its breathtaking terrain. Whether you seek solitude in nature or an opportunity to learn about conservation efforts, Glacier National Park promises an unforgettable journey through some of America's most awe-inspiring scenery.
